Herpes vs. HIV: What’s the Difference Between Them?
... They might also take a sample from a sore to send to a lab. If there are no visible symptoms, a blood test can check for HSV antibodies — proteins your body makes after being exposed to the virus.The only way to know if you have an HIV infection is to get tested. HIV can be diagnosed using a sample of blood or saliva. ...
